Publisher's Synopsis

Modern Inference Based on Health Related Markers: Biomarkers and Statistical Decision Making provides a compendium of biomarkers based methodologies for respective health related fields and health related marker-specific biostatistical techniques. The book introduces correct and efficient testing mechanisms, including procedures based on bootstrap and permutation methods with the aim of making these techniques assessable to practical researchers. In the biostatistical aspect, it describes how to correctly state testing problems, but it also includes novel results, which have appeared in current statistical publications. In addition, the book discusses also modern applied statistical developments that consider data-driven techniques, including empirical likelihood methods and other simple and efficient methods to derive statistical tools for use in health related studies.
